    Char Siu
    By Xexe on October 18, 2002

    Recipe #43633

    "The reason for roasting the pork over a pan of water is that when the water heats up, it creates steam that circulates around the pork and moderates the oven temperature as well--both prevents the pork from drying out."

    Lo-bak Go - Chinese Radish Cakes
    By Jenny Sanders on January 25, 2005

    Recipe #109483

    "This is my favourite Chinese Dim-Sum. It is a steamed cake of rice flour and grated Chinese radish (lo-bak), which is then cut into slices and pan fried. Not unlike scrapple, in some ways, although less meaty. It's delicious with lots of hot sauce. Lo-bak looks very similar to daikon; it is just a little bit milder in flavour. I suspect daikon..."

    Happy Bird Crosses The Golden Bridge
    By Mille® on March 4, 2002

    Recipe #21474

    ""Happy Bird Crosses The Golden Bridge" presents an attractive image featuring the pigeon, a symbol of happiness to the Chinese. The inclusion of winter melon, a summertime seasonal vegetable, as the imagined "golden bridge" is a culinary play on words: the dish combines two traditional dishes providing a bridge between their contrasting..."
